Ashiya Shi, Hyōgo, Japan

Overview

Ashiya Shi is an upscale and tranquil city set between Kobe and Osaka in Hyōgo, Japan. Renowned for its elegant neighborhoods, green spaces, and refined local culture, Ashiya offers a serene atmosphere amid urban convenience.

Best Time to Visit

March-May for cherry blossoms and pleasant spring weather, or October-November for autumn foliage.

Local Tips

Train is the fastest way to travel between Ashiya, Kobe, and Osaka. Bicycles are a popular way to explore quiet residential areas. Most shops close by 8pm, so plan your evenings accordingly.

Cultural Etiquette

No tipping is expected. Dress neatly, especially in upscale areas. Always be punctual for appointments, and avoid phone conversations on public transport.

Safety Warnings

Ashiya is very safe with extremely low crime. However, be cautious crossing quiet residential streets as cars may drive quickly. Watch for occasional typhoons in summer.

Hidden Gems

Visit Ashiya Rock Garden for hiking, stroll through Ashiya Park's rose garden, and enjoy local pastries at historic bakeries hidden among residential streets.
